+ Many PHP developers utilize email in their code.  The only PHP function
+ that supports this is the mail() function.  However, it does not expose
+ any of the popular features that many email clients use nowadays like
+ HTML-based emails and attachments. There are two proprietary
+ development tools out there that have all the functionality built into
+ easy to use classes: AspEmail(tm) and AspMail.  Both of these
+ programs are COM components only available on Windows.
+ .
+ PhpMailer implements the same methods (object  calls) that the Windows-based
+ components do.
+ .
+ Class Features:
+  - Send emails with multiple TOs, CCs, BCCs and REPLY-TOs
+  - Redundant SMTP servers
+  - Multipart/alternative emails for mail clients that do not read HTML email
+  - Support for 8bit, base64, binary, and quoted-printable encoding
+  - Uses the same methods as the very popular AspEmail active server (COM)
+    component
+  - SMTP authentication
+  - Native language support
+  - Word wrap, and more!
